Fri. Jun 13th, 2025
Smart Contracts The Future of Agreements?

What are Smart Contracts?

Smart contracts are self-executing contracts with the terms of the agreement between buyer and seller being directly written into lines of code. They’re stored on a blockchain, a decentralized and immutable ledger, ensuring transparency and security. Unlike traditional contracts that rely on intermediaries like lawyers and notaries, smart contracts automate the execution of the agreement once predetermined conditions are met. This automation eliminates the need for trust between parties, as the code itself governs the agreement.

How Smart Contracts Work: A Simple Analogy

Imagine you’re buying a house. A traditional contract would involve lawyers, paperwork, and potentially months of delays before the funds transfer and ownership changes hands. With a smart contract, the agreement is programmed to release the funds to the seller automatically once the buyer provides proof of ownership transfer (e.g., a digitally signed property deed verified on the blockchain). The entire process becomes streamlined and significantly faster.

Smart Contracts The Future of Agreements?

Transparency and Immutability: Key Advantages

The blockchain’s nature provides two crucial advantages: transparency and immutability. All participants can see the contract’s terms and execution history, promoting trust and accountability. Once a transaction is recorded on the blockchain, it cannot be altered or deleted, ensuring the integrity of the agreement. This is a huge step up from traditional contracts, which can be vulnerable to tampering or disputes over interpretation.

RELATED ARTICLE  Understanding Termination Know Your Rights

Beyond Simple Transactions: Expanding Applications

Smart contracts are not limited to simple transactions like buying and selling goods. Their applications span diverse industries. In supply chain management, they can track goods from origin to destination, ensuring authenticity and preventing counterfeiting. In the insurance sector, they can automate payouts based on predetermined events. In the healthcare industry, they can facilitate secure data sharing and medical record management. The possibilities are vast and constantly expanding.

Challenges and Limitations of Smart Contracts

Despite their potential, smart contracts face challenges. Developing robust and secure code is crucial, as vulnerabilities can be exploited. Legal frameworks are still catching up, creating uncertainty around the enforceability of smart contracts in certain jurisdictions. Furthermore, integrating smart contracts with existing systems can be complex and expensive. The reliance on technology also brings its own set of vulnerabilities like hacking, unforeseen circumstances that the code cannot predict, and errors in the initial design and implementation of the smart contracts.

The Future of Agreements: A Paradigm Shift

Smart contracts are poised to revolutionize how we conduct agreements. Their efficiency, transparency, and security offer significant advantages over traditional methods. While challenges remain, ongoing development and increased adoption are likely to pave the way for a future where automated, secure, and transparent agreements become the norm across various sectors. As the technology matures and legal frameworks adapt, smart contracts will become increasingly integrated into our daily lives, transforming business interactions and personal transactions alike.

Security and Auditing: Mitigating Risks

The security of smart contracts is paramount. Rigorous auditing and testing are essential to identify and mitigate vulnerabilities before deployment. Using established coding best practices and employing security experts can significantly reduce the risks of exploitation. Furthermore, continuous monitoring and updates are necessary to address any emerging threats or vulnerabilities.

RELATED ARTICLE  Streamline Software Licensing The New SaaS Manager

Legal and Regulatory Considerations: Navigating the Uncharted Territory

The legal landscape surrounding smart contracts is evolving rapidly. Questions regarding jurisdiction, enforceability, and liability are still being debated and clarified. Collaboration between legal professionals and technologists is crucial to develop clear and effective legal frameworks that govern the use of smart contracts. This will increase confidence in this emerging technology and ensure it’s used responsibly.

Interoperability and Scalability: Addressing Technological Hurdles

For smart contracts to achieve widespread adoption, they need to be interoperable across different blockchain platforms. This requires standardized protocols and frameworks that allow different systems to communicate seamlessly. Scalability is another crucial factor; ensuring that the underlying blockchain technology can handle a large volume of transactions without compromising speed or efficiency is vital for mass adoption. Read more about Digital contract enforcement.

Related Post